The technology behind laminate flooring has advanced dramatically in recent years. High-definition digital imaging now captures every grain pattern, knot, and subtle color variation found in natural hardwood. Manufacturers use embossed-in-register technology, which means the texture you feel underfoot actually matches the printed grain pattern. When you run your hand across a quality laminate plank, you feel realistic wood grain exactly where your eyes see it. This level of detail makes it nearly impossible for most people to distinguish laminate from genuine hardwood in a side-by-side comparison.

Durability is where laminate truly outshines many traditional flooring options. The wear layer on premium laminate products resists scratches, dents, and fading with remarkable effectiveness. Families with children, pet owners, and anyone who lives an active lifestyle benefit enormously from this resilience. Dropped toys, pet claws, heavy foot traffic, and rolling office chairs pose virtually no threat to a well-made laminate floor. Many products now carry warranties of 25 years or more, giving homeowners confidence in their investment.

Water resistance represents another major breakthrough in laminate technology. Earlier generations of laminate were notoriously vulnerable to moisture, swelling and warping at the first sign of a spill. Today's waterproof laminate collections feature sealed edges and hydrophobic core materials that can withstand standing water for extended periods. This innovation has opened up rooms that were previously off-limits for laminate, including kitchens, bathrooms, and laundry rooms.

Installation has also become more homeowner-friendly, though professional installation still delivers the best results. Click-lock systems allow planks to snap together without glue, creating tight seams that look seamless. Underlayment options have improved as well, providing better sound absorption and thermal comfort. Walking across modern laminate feels warm and comfortable, nothing like the hollow, plastic-sounding floors of decades past.
